I am a professional guitarist with a degree in music from Western Kentucky University with an emphasis in classical guitar and jazz under Professor John Martin. I have played guitar for 20 years in a variety of styles ranging from Classical, Blues, Rock, Metal, Fingerstyle, Pop, Country, Gospel, Contemperary and many others. I have been a studio session player and gigged regularly since starting. I studied under the phenomenal jazz-fusion/gypsy jazz guitarist Dani Rabin from the band Marbin and Kieran Johnston from the Scotland metal band Perpertua, jazz improv under trumpeter Dr. Marshall Scott and from Grammy Award winner guitarist Greg Martin. Have worked with artists, audio engineers, and producers such as Chris Robertson (Black Stone Cherry), John King (Sixth Floor, South Bound, Sons of the Revolution, Mud River Revival), Kenton Embry (Nashville Session player and touring artist), Russell Brooks (The Schools, 00 The Rabbit, Solo artist), David Barrick(BarrickStudios), Jason Simpson (Colter Wall). Has shared the stage with Cage The Elephant, Morning Teleportation, Derick St. Holmes (Ted Nugent), Jesse Keith Whitley, Alabama Shakes, Taildragger, Schools, Moon Taxi, Sleeper Agent, and others.
In addition I am a composer, arranger and also play a variety of other instruments as bass, piano, ukulele, mandolin, percussion, and extended range guitars. Also familiar with several music production softwares such as Finale, Logic, Cubase, Presonus Studio-One, iRealPro, Guitar Pro, Garage Band, Line 6 HX Edit, Sound Slice and Protools.
I have an extensive knowledge of music theory which he applies to lessons, as well as ear training, harmony, solfege and sight reading just to name a few and depending on the wishes of the student. At my alma mater was a member in the guitar ensemble, guitar quartet, jazz band, and classical solo guitar. I also participated in music theory, jazz improv, orchestral arranging, piano, choral arranging, form & analysis, conducting, aural skills, music drama, and music history.

METHODS, STYLES, & LESSONS
The goal at Prestige Guitar is to keep the lessons fresh, interesting, and to ultimately guide the students to educate themselves as they gain experience and familiarity with the instrument. With lessons that are tailored to the styles our students wish to pursue, we can build upon their strengths and focus on opportunities to improve weaker areas. Every student is unique. For some, music becomes a passion, others, a new hobby. Whatever the goal, Prestige Guitar is here to help!
